The Ordovician Fault Activity And Hydrocarbon Accumulation On The Maigaiti Slope

The Maigaiti slope experienced a multi-stage tectonic movement during its formation and evolution,and because of the tectonic stress field changing several times,developing a multi-stage fault structure has become a prominent feature of the slope zone.The tectonic deformation patterns of different fault structures in the Maigaiti slope are different,and the formation and evolution of multi-stage fault structures are complex,so it's difficult to understand the tectonic style,combination relationship,formation age,evolution process and genetic mechanism.The oil and gas reservoirs discovered in the slope area are all developed in the fault tectonic belt,and the fault activities control hydrocarbon accumulation obviously.Based on the theories of modern tectonic geology,structural analysis,fault-related fold,and the means of balanced cross-section technique,it will be studied the faulting activity of Maigaiti slope and its control on oil and gas.There are the following conclusions:(1)Fault activity plays an important role in improving lithology.The upper wall and lower wall of the fault have an effect on sedimentary thickness,it controls the distribution of hydrocarbon source rocks and reservoir-cap assemblages,and it cuts down the Cambrian hydrocarbon downward.The fault also can be used as an important hydrocarbon migration channel.(2)The temporal and spatial matching relationship is closely related to the history of fault development and evolution and various reservoir elements,which directly determine the migration and occurrence of oil and gas.Most of the traps in the southwestern part of the tower are developed in the fault zone.On the background of ancient buried hills,the fault activity is weak,and there are not only structural types of traps,but stratigraphic traps and ancient buried hill traps.(3)The deep and large faults may lead to a large number of oil and gas loss along the faults,causing the ancient oil and gas reservoirs to be destroyed and readjusted.
